Learning outcomes
This course aims to familiarise students with the fundamental and the most practically used algorithms and methods of the computers graphics including scan conversion of geometric primitives, 2D and 3D geometric transformations, clipping and filling, algorithms for visible surface determination, use of raster and vector graphics, demonstration of common image formats and next. The accent is given to the implementation of selected algorithm in Java language.
After finishing the course the student is able to create simple graphical applications for display of raster and vector objects and applications for a basic adjustment of raster images. Student is able to use basic graphics instrument supported by the graphics library of Delphi. Student is able to implement the selected methods and algorithms of computer graphics.
Prerequisites
Assumed basic knowledge of PC operating system MS Windows. The foundations of algorithm development and basic programming experience in a higher programming language and elementary geometry and linear algebra acquirements are required.
